Benjamin Brian Ferguson passed away on December 1, 2022, in Chattanooga, Tennessee, surrounded by family.

Ben was born in Longview, Tx., on March 19, 1982. He lived all over the world, including Hong Kong, Canada, and Switzerland. He earned a BA from Moody Bible Institute in Biblical Languages and received a Masters of Divinity from Regent College-Vancouver. As a husband, father, son, brother, friend, and as a pastor of Mission Chattanooga, Ben blessed countless people, each of whom he knew was counted by God.

Ben is survived by his wife, Mary Romero Ferguson, and their daughters, Amelie Joy, 10, and Lucy Grace, 7.
